ENERGY CRISIS INTRODUCTION 1. An energy crisis is any great shortfall (or price rise) in the supply of energy resources to an economy. It usually refers to the shortage of oil and additionally to electricity or other natural resources. The crisis often has effects on the rest of the economy‚ with many recessions being caused by an energy crisis in some form. re-grown‚ regenerated‚ or reused on a scale which can sustain its consumption rate. These resources often exist in a fixed amount‚ or are consumed much faster than nature can recreate them. Fossil fuel (such as coal‚ petroleum and natural gas) and nuclear power are examples. Recall also that kinetic energy comes in six forms - chemical‚ electrical‚ radiant‚ mechanical‚ nuclear‚ and thermal- and that each of these forms can be converted into any of the other forms. For example‚ a battery converts chemical energy into electricity‚ and a light bulb converts electricity into light and heat. Not all energy conversions are a simple as turning on a light bulb.
